Elizabeth Lauraine Sedgwick was born in 1755 in Cornwall, Litchfield, Connecticut, USA, the child of Benjamin Sedgwick And Anne Thompson. Elizabeth Lauraine Sedgwick married Jacob Orlando Parsons Capt, and had children including Orlando Parsons. Elizabeth Lauraine Sedgwick passed away in 1823 in Whitney Point, Broome County, New York, United States of America.
